THE OPPORTUNITY:
Utilise your Advanced Sustainable Nutrient Management certification and environmental or dairy farm background in this new Dairy Farm Auditor role.
Visit customers farms in the Canterbury region to conduct audits and assessments for assurance programmes. The purpose of these audits is to help customers ensure excellence in environmental outcomes, animal health & wellbeing, infrastructure, and staff management.
Reporting to the Area Manager of Farm Systems Auditing, you will be part of a team of 12 and often work in pairs to visit customers farms to complete audits and provide similar livestock services.
This is a full-time permanent position that will involve working minimum 40 hours per week, Monday to Friday. Start times will vary depending on timing of scheduled audits with dairy farms.
KEY REQUIREMENTS:
- Have an Advanced Sustainable Nutrient Management certification from Massey University.
- Be well organised, have excellent customer service and strong relationship building skills, as the Dairy companies and farmers are clients paying for your service.
- Ability to do occasional domestic travel and have a clean and current NZ driver’s licence.
- It’s important that you are comfortable being on farms near livestock / large animals.
- Flexible with your work hours adapting to match when audits are scheduled to take place.

Responsibilities:
- Complete 3-4 audits per week. Each onsite audit can take on average 6 hours to conduct.
- Maintain a positive relationship with farming customers while also holding them accountable to the rules and regulations.
- Collaborate with team members and other stakeholders in the business to learn and share knowledge in a way that will help maintain a culture of continuous improvement and excellence in service delivery.
- Actively participate in on the job learning and adapting to new or updated regulations and programmes.
